The ingredients needed to make Lentil & potato pressure cooker vegetable soup:

  1. Take 8 cups of broth.
  2. Use 1 cup of lentils (or barley or rice would probably work too.).
  3. Get 3 of small potatoes, diced.
  4. Use 2-3 cloves of garlic.
  5. Get 1-1/2 of cup, approx, Celery, sliced,.
  6. Take 2 of onions, diced.
  7. Prepare 1 of tomato, diced.
  8. Take of ~1-1/2 cups green beans(or whatever other leftover veg you have).
  9. Provide 1 of dried habanero.
  10. Take of ~1 tbsp Butter.
  11. Provide of ~1 tsp Olive oil.
  12. Provide 1 tbsp of Paprika, at least.
  13. Take to taste of Oregano.
  14. Provide to taste of Basil.
  15. Provide To taste of pepper.
  16. Take Dash of thyme.
  17. You need 2 of bay leafs.
  18. Take Dash of Sherry if you've got it.

Instructions to make Lentil & potato pressure cooker vegetable soup:

  1. Set electric pressure cooker (Instant pot or other) to brown.
  2. Melt butter and brown onions in it until they're good and caramelized on the outside..
  3. While onions are browning chop up any veggies that aren't prepared yet and the habanero pepper..
  4. Add all other ingredients to onions, including broth. Stir.
  5. Set pressure cooker to high pressure for 18 minutes.
  6. When time is up, fast release pressure and serve..

Lentils are grouped with beans and peas as part of the legume family because, like all legumes, they grow in pods. Lentils are high in protein and fiber and low in fat, which makes them a healthy substitute for meat. For millennia, lentils have been traditionally been eaten with barley and wheat, three foodstuffs that originated in the same regions and spread throughout Africa and Europe during similar migrations and explorations of cultural tribes.
